Leicester go top of Premiership with win against Worcester

Scott HamiltonLeicester went top of the Premiership table following their narrow 19-14 victory over Worcester at Sixways tonight.
David Lemi with a try and Andy Goode with three penalties gave the Warriors a 14-0 lead after 20 minutes but a try on the last play of the half from Scott Hamilton brought Leicester back to 14-5 at the break.
The visitors were awarded a penalty try to cut down the deficit to two points 15 minutes into the second half before referee JP Doyle went under the posts again on the last minute of the game to hand the Tigers the win.
